Full-year nonresidents of California filing Form 540NR, while not subject to the state's requirement that residents have qualifying health care coverage, nonetheless are subject to the same reporting requirement as residents.
Thus, the nonresident return requires you to indicate whether or not the taxpayer and their family had full-year minimum essential coverage (MEC), and if not to complete Form 3853, Health Coverage Exemptions and Individual Shared Responsibility Penalty.
First, you will need to indicate in the California nonresident return whether or not the taxpayer and their family had full-year MEC. To do this, from the California Return menu select:
- Health Care Shared Responsibility Tax (Form 3853)
- Did the Taxpayer have Full year minimum essential health care coverage for all members of the household? - If everyone in the household had full-year MEC, click Yes then click Continue and you're done with the healthcare section of the return.
If the answer to the healthcare question is No, you'll need to complete Form 3853 and you will indicate that they are exempt from the MEC due to being nonresidents.
For a nonresident, completing Form 3853 is a two-step process:
- You will indicate the nonresident exemption for the months that exemption applies.
- You will indicate the months the taxpayer had either MEC or an exemption.
Step 1 - indicating the months the nonresident exemption applies.
- Part III - Coverage Exemptions
- Enter California Coverage Exemptions for Household members that were claimed on Federal return
-
Part III - California Coverage Exemptions - You will need to click this for each individual in the return and indicate their coverage or exemption status for either the full year or for each month, as applicable.
-
Select the individual - Select the individual whose coverage status you are indicating.
-
Full Year - If they had full year coverage or are covered by the nonresident exemption, click the drop down menu and select "Health Coverage" or "Nonresident or Part year resident".
or -
January - December - For a given month, if the individual had health coverage or are claiming an exemption, click that month's drop down menu and select "Health Coverage" or "Nonresident or Part year resident".
When finished with everyone in the return, return to the CA Form 3853 Healthcare menu.

Step 2 - indicating the months the taxpayer had either MEC or an exemption.
- Shared Responsibility Payment
- Shared responsibility payment for individuals claimed on Federal return
- Shared Responsibility Payment - You will need to click this for each individual in the return and indicate Yes for each month of the year.
